ACCESSIBLE FIELD SPORTS: THE EXPERIENCES OF A SPORTSMAN IN NORTH AMERICA
1869 · London
by [Gillmore, Parker]
London, 1869. xii,336pp. Frontis. Engraved titlepage. Later burgundy cloth, spine gilt. Cloth lightly edgeworn. Some foxing to preliminary leaves, else internally clean. Bookplate of Hermon Dunlap Smith. Very good. The author traveled on the Santa Fe Trail in the 1850s and wrote other works on his experiences in the West. Chapter six of the present book is devoted entirely to buffalo hunting. Also chapters on shooting in Illinois, trout fishing in Maine, etc (Inventory #: WRCAM18810)
